Stories: Pennsylvania Potluck: Fastnacht

November 8, 2006
Tweet Share Google+ Email

New Orleans has Mardi Gras. Rio has Carnivale. In the Susquehannah Valley, the day before Lent is "Fastnacht Day," when you eat the deep-fried treats called fastnacht! In this installment of "Pennsylvania Potluck," we visit Holy Trinity Church in Lancaster County, which is famous for its fastnacht.
